Electrodynamics of a three-level Jaynes-Cummings model in a Kerr-like medium

V. Bartzis and N. Patargias

Physica A: Statistical Mechanics and its Applications, 1994, vol. 206, issue 1, 207-217

Abstract: In this paper we study the dynamics of a three level Jaynes-Cummings model (J-C model) interacting with a Kerr-like medium. We examine the influence of the Kerr medium coupling in the time evolution of the level population as well as in the squeezing phenomenon which is found to be stronger.
